JustARalf Posted April 15, 2023 Posted April 15, 2023 Designer V2 (2.0.4.5) iPad Pro (12,9”, 3. Generation) iPadOS 16.4.1 It’s exactly what the title says… To recreate the issue follow these steps: 1. Open a new document (size doesn’t really matter) 2. Create a simple shape, e.g. a rectangle 3. Export as PDF (PDF for print presets) (“Rect.pdf”) 4. Open another new document (“Test”) 5. Place and position “Rect.pdf” 6. Double click the shape (in this case the rectangle). A new window should open where you can edit Rect.pdf’s content. 7. Return to “Test”, in my case since I am using a keyboard by hitting command-w8. “Test” is dead: the file can’t be opened nor saved. This is particularly unnerving after having spent several hours working on a project. “You should’ve saved the project outside of Designer” is probably good advice, however I kinda expect the application not to kill my projects if I act on its invitation to work conveniently inside the app’s environment. Dan C Posted April 17, 2023 Posted April 17, 2023 Hi @JustARalf, Thanks for your report! I tested your method above here and I was unable to replicate this issue, until I connected a keyboard and used CMD+W to close the embedded PDF that was being edited. It appears as though when using CMD+W both the embedded document view "Rect" and the main document "Test" are closed incorrectly, causing the document to become corrupted. Only the "Rect" document should be closed when using this shortcut. If you select the 'back' arrow in the top left corner when editing the embedded document, rather than using the CMD+W shortcut, this should not occur. I will be logging this as a bug with our developers now to be resolved ASAP. Our sincerest apologies for any inconveniences caused due to this. Quote

Staff Affinity Info Bot Posted April 19, 2023 Staff Posted April 19, 2023 The issue "If a document is closed on the iPad whilst editing an embedded file it will cause the document to fail to open again" (REF: AFD-5299) has been fixed by the developers in internal build "2.1.0.1769". This fix should soon be available as a customer beta and is planned for inclusion in the next customer release.
